I just checked online cause I couldn't believe that movieworld could be bigger than Disneyland,
Currently movieworld is around 30hectares, although the parcel of land next to the original studios is 168 hectares. That makes more sense.

Back to the original question, I just used "mapfrappe" to overlay an outline of Disneyland (just the DL park, not California adventure, Downtown Disney or the resort hotels/carparks etc) with Movieworld (just the rides area, not the carpark, Wet & Wild, Outback Spectacular, Paradise country up in the hills behind behind etc). Movieworld is less than half the size of just Disneyland (scroll to the second map where the overlay is, scaled to match).

http://mapfrappe.com/?show=12334


ETA - little bits of movie world are chopped off and other little bits added in for that overlay, but I think the extra missed out/added in would even out.
